Abstract
In this paper, we present new experimental results on the generation of ultrafast third (266nm), fifth (160nm), and seventh (114nm) harmonic light in gases. Useful conversion efficiencies are observed, and the efficiency can be optimized by adjusting the chirp of the input pulse. In addition, the pulse duration of the third harmonic is measured at under 16fs, using the technique of self-diffraction frequency resolved optical gating.
